MCMC recording statements from TMI staff


PETALING JAYA: The Malaysian Communication and Multimedia Commission (MCMC) are recording statements from management and staff of The Malaysian Insider (TMI), involved in the publishing of an article on hudud and the Conference of Rulers.

Those arrested including The Edge publisher Ho Kay Tat, TMI managing editor Lionel Morais and senior editors Amin Iskandar and Zulkifli Sulong are still at the Dang Wangi district police headquarters, and are expected to be released Tuesday evening.
